Position Summary

The Manufacturing Equipment Reliability Engineer improves equipment reliability availability maintainability and performance across XL Systems global facilities supporting large OD threaded conductor manufacturing.

This role provides hands-on technical support to operations and maintenance teams focusing on identifying prioritizing and implementing reliability improvements that reduce downtime enhance process stability support safe production and increase equipment effectiveness. The role primarily supports the Beaumont Texas facility while contributing to global manufacturing engineering initiatives and future automation projects.

As the primary reliability-focused engineering resource this position requires strong self-leadership technical judgment disciplined documentation and the ability to drive improvements through collaboration with manufacturing engineers maintenance personnel operations leaders and other stakeholders.

Key Responsibilities

  • Lead equipment reliability improvement efforts for large CNC threading machines SAW welding lines pipe conveying equipment and related manufacturing systems.
  • Identify recurring equipment failures downtime drivers process instability and maintenance gaps using data observation operator input and maintenance history.
  • Conduct root cause analysis and recommend practical corrective and preventive actions to improve uptime reliability safety quality and throughput.
  • Develop update and maintain technical documentation troubleshooting guides repair procedures preventive maintenance instructions and standard work for maintenance teams.
  • Partner with maintenance and operations to improve preventive maintenance programs spare parts strategies inspection criteria and equipment care practices.
  • Provide technical guidance to operations and maintenance teams during troubleshooting repair planning equipment recovery and reliability improvement activities.
  • Prioritize reliability projects based on business impact safety downtime reduction process stability and resource availability.
  • Lead implementation of reliability improvements from problem definition through execution verification and sustainment.
  • Support manufacturing engineering projects equipment upgrades automation initiatives and process improvement efforts at Beaumont and other global facilities as needed.
  • Collaborate with internal teams vendors and equipment specialists to evaluate failure modes technical solutions equipment modifications and long-term reliability improvements.
  • Monitor improvement effectiveness using measurable indicators such as downtime repeat failures repair frequency PM compliance mean time between failures mean time to repair and production impact.
  • Support safe work practices by ensuring equipment changes procedures and maintenance recommendations consider safety ergonomics maintainability and operational risk.
  • Communicate technical recommendations clearly to maintenance operations engineering and leadership audiences.
  • Maintain strong ownership of assigned projects follow through on commitments and provide timely updates on progress risks barriers and results.

Success Measures

Success in this role may be measured by observable improvements in:

  • Reduced unplanned downtime on critical equipment.
  • Reduced repeat failures and emergency repairs.
  • Improved preventive maintenance effectiveness and completion quality.
  • Improved troubleshooting speed and repair consistency through better documentation.
  • Improved equipment availability process stability and production support.
  • Successful implementation of prioritized reliability and automation improvement projects.
  • Strong feedback from maintenance operations manufacturing engineering and leadership on technical support and follow-through.

Work Environment

This role is based primarily at the Beaumont Texas manufacturing facility and requires regular presence on the production floor. The position may require occasional support for other global facilities including remote collaboration and possible travel based on business needs.
